Sometimes taxpayers accidentally open the 1099-R screen which adds a 1099-R even though they actually didn't want to and didn't enter any data.

#1 If you don't have any 1099-Rs, then try the following (this is for the Online product):

  • Go to Tax Tools (on the left).
  • Select Tools and click on "Delete a form" under the Tools Center that appears.
  • You will now see a long list of "forms" (many are just worksheets).
  • You should delete anything that begins with "Form 1099-R", and after you have deleted any and all, go farther down the list and delete "Forms 1099-R Summary".

#2 If on the other hand, you do have a 1099-R , then you need to return to the entry section for 1099-Rs (Federal->Wages & Income->Retirement Plans & Social Security and click on "IRA, 401(k), Pension Plan Withdrawals (1099-R)"). You should see a list of 1099-Rs that you have entered. 

If there is one or more 1099-Rs that don't have a name (in the Paid By column), then this is probably an incomplete 1099-R that was accidentally created. If you don't know what it is, deleted it (on the far right).

Then recheck your entries on the other 1099-Rs (if any), and continue your return.
